Title:
ELECTRIC-FIELD ELECTRON EMISSION-TYPE SURGE ABSORBING ELEMENT AND ITS MANUFACTURE

Abstract:

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ide an electric-field electron emission-type surge absorbing element that allows its operating voltage to be set lower easily by devising constituents of a protective film covering emitter cones.
SOLUTION: In this surge absorbing element 10, a first substrate member 12 composed of an n-type semiconductor having an electron emitting part on which multiple emitter cones 20 are formed and a second substrate member 14 composed of an n-type semiconductor having a flat surface on which no emitter cone is formed are so arranged that a tip 20a of each emitter cone and the flat surface are placed to face to each other being separated from each other by a predetermined distance; the peripheries of both the substrate members 12, 14 are sealed airtightly interposing a frame 16 so as to form an enclosure 18, the inside of which is kept in a high vacuum condition; a first external electrode 24 and a second electrode 26 are formed on the outside surfaces of both the substrate members 12, 14, respectively. In this case, a protective film 22 composed of a diamond thin film is formed on the surfaces of the emitter cones 20.
